Judee Tan: “The Noose Is Coming Back For Season 7”

[UPDATE: January 1, 2014]

A representative from MediaCorp’s Channel 5 has confirmed exclusively to Popspoken that The Noose will be back on April 1 2014, after the premiere date was announced during the Celebrate TV50 countdown party’s live broadcast. In the TV announcement, an image was shown of popular character Barbarella, played by Michelle Chong, with the words “I’m Back”.

Michelle Chong left the show after Season 5 to focus on her career as artiste manager of company Left Profile as well as director of films Almost Famous and 3 Peas In A Pod.

Funnywoman Judee Tan revealed to Popspoken at the MediaCorp Radio Awards that the acclaimed news comedy series The Noose will return to English free-to-air Channel 5 for a seventh season.

This means The Noose is set to tie with Singapore comedy series Under One Roof, which also clocked seven seasons before ending its run in 2003. Another Singapore comedy series, Phua Chu Kang Pte Ltd, clocked eight seasons during its run.

Judee was present at the awards ceremony to present the four awards of Radio Personality of the Year — Media’s Choice in the four national languages that radio programming falls under. Judee presented the awards together with Anthony Neely and Michelle Chong, the latter slyly plugging her new film 3 Peas In A Pod while making her introductions.

Judee told us that she has not received the script for the comedy’s new iteration yet but said that filming should happen sometime early next year. She got her big break into television for The Noose’s fourth season after producers spotted her at a skit for annual revue Chestnuts doing an impersonation of infamous beauty queen Ris Low.

At the awards ceremony, Judee was also part of a hilarious video trailer introducing the Radio Personality of the Year — Media’s Choice category criteria. When asked if she considers herself as a funnywoman or if it is a title she feels is too heavy for her to carry, she tussled with this reporter before jokingly conceding defeat.

“Ok lah, I think I’m funny lah,” said Judee.

Judee will also appear in the upcoming Crazy Christmas play by Dream Academy, an annual staple in the Singapore theatre calender. When asked if one of her hilarious characters Dr Teo Chew Moi was going to make an appearance at the play, she said no but assured us that fans will get to see the crazy traditional Chinese medicine doctor “soon”, declining to go into specifics.

It is not known if Judee will reprise her Noose characters Kim Bong Cha and See Yann Yann or will she take on newer roles. Judee is the only female actor left standing in the Noose roster, after Michelle Chong left the series after Season 5 to focus on her film-making and artiste management career.
